Thermodynamics!

MS80 now does basic simulation of thermodynamics, using real SI units.

Heat builds up on components as they operate, and if they get too hot, they can fail.

To test these systems, I added a new turret enemy, inspired by Receiver. You can use the laser to melt components off of it, and eventually you'll be able to scavenge them.

We currently only simulate convective heat transfer, but conduction between components is going to happen really soon.

I'm also excited about making hot stuff glow and radiate heat; I think it's going to look really cool.
